Output 3d1dd55f0ecee95b36bef58bc2fbf04c6c439d162065b4f99cb80bf5ce4fe23a:1

value
559772059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 458baa3a69e9743b9cff7ac48c23001e5a79285e OP_EQUALVERIFY OP_CHECKSIG
address
17LiwKzRY5v3VR1axaHJx4PWNTkjNP6qrH
transaction
3d1dd55f0ecee95b36bef58bc2fbf04c6c439d162065b4f99cb80bf5ce4fe23a
spent
true